![](/user_photo/1438_p9ksI.png)
Производственный (операционный) менеджмент - В.А.Василенко, Т.И.Ткаченко
.pdf![](/html/1438/356/html_tUn5EFvP8z.S5fz/htmlconvd-b1oA1V271x1.jpg)
Продолжительность каждого вида работ определяется по технологическим картам, ЕНиР – Единые нормы и расценки – старые нормативы или укрупненные новые – ДБН (Державні будівельні норми), выработке, имеющейся трудоемкости или применительно к существующим нормам предприятия.
Длительность ведения работ, сменность и число исполнителей могут проставляться в любой период построения СМ, так как эти данные на топологию сети (взаиморасположение работ и событий) влияния не оказывают. Они необходимы лишь для расчета, то есть процесса превращения СМ в сетевой график (СГ).
13.3. Параметры модели и расчет графика
Расчет сетевой модели (графика) заключается в определении критического пути и резервов времени по каждой работе, которые необходимы для правильного распределения ресурсов и их перераспределения при планировании и управлении производством.
Для расчета сетевого графика вводятся следующие основные обозначения и понятия, называемые параметрами СГ:
•событие, стоящее в начале данной работы, i;
•событие, стоящее в конце данной работы, j;
•событие, стоящее в конце последующей работы, k;
•продолжительность данной работы, ti-j;
•продолжительность последующей работы, tj-k;
•ранний срок начала работы, tip−.нj ;
•ранний срок окончания работы, tip−.оj ;
•поздний срок начала работы, ti-j;
•поздний срок окончания работы, ti-j;
•частный резерв времени работы, ri-j;
•общий резерв времени работы, Ri-j;
•длина критического пути, Ткр.
Сетевой график рассчитывают на основе аналитических зависимостей, отражающих взаимосвязь параметров простейшей сети по схеме, показанной на рис. 4.10.
h |
i |
j |
k |
Рис.4 10. Расчетная схема сетевого графика.
h-i – предшествующая работа; i-j - данная работа; j-k – последующая работа.
Ранний срок начала данной работы, tip−.нj – это самый ранний срок, в который можно
начать данную работу. Он определяется длиной максимального пути от исходного события до начала данной работы (maxΣ ti-j).Он также соответствует максимальной величине ранних окончаний предшествующих работ. Раннее начало всех работ, выходящих из исходного события, принимается равным нулю.
Ранний срок окончания данной работы, tip−.оj определяется длиной критического пути
от исходного события до окончания работы или равно раннему сроку начала данной работы плюс ее продолжительность:
tiр−.оj = tiр−.нj + ti− j , |
(4.1) |
Ранние сроки начала и окончания работ определяют последовательным переходом от события к событию, слева направо по направлению стрелок.
271
Если данной работе i-j предшествует лишь один процесс h-i, то ее раннее начало будет равно раннему окончанию работы h-i. Согласно расчетной схеме
tiр−.нj = thр−.oj или tiр−.kн = tiр−.oj , |
(4.2) |
Поздний срок начала работы tip−.нj – самый поздний срок, который не вызывает задерж-
ки окончания всех работ и позволяет начать данную работу без увеличения общих сроков. Позднее начало любой работы определяют как разность между ее поздним окончанием и продолжительностью самой работы:
tiр−.нj = tiр−.оj − ti− j . |
(4.3) |
Поздние сроки начала и окончания работ определяют обратным ходом, т.е. справа на-
лево.
Поздний срок окончания данной работы определяют по позднему началу последующей работы:
tiр−.оj = tiр−.kн . |
(4.4) |
Если за данной работой следует не одна, а несколько, то ее позднее окончание будет равно минимальному значению из всех поздних начал последующих работ:
tiр−.оj = min tiр−.нj |
(4.5) |
Для работ критического пути ранние и поздние сроки начала и окончания соответственно равны (то же качается исходного и завершающего событий):
tiр−.нj = tiп−.нj ; tiр−.оj = tiп−.оj . |
(4.6) |
Каждая некритическая работа может иметь два вида резервов времени: общий (полный) и частный (свободный).
Общий (полный) резерв времени Ri-j показывает, насколько может быть увеличена продолжительность данной работы или перенесено ее начало на более поздний срок без нарушения продолжительности критического пути.
Если общий резерв времени будет использован, то данная работа становится крити-
ческой.
Общий резерв времени может быть определен по разности позднего и раннего начала или позднего и раннего окончания работ
t р.о = t р.н + t |
i− j |
или |
R |
= tп.o |
− t р.о . (4.7) |
i− j i− j |
|
i− j |
i− j |
i− j |
Общий резерв времени можно также определить, располагая данными только о началах работ: по разности позднего начала последующей работы, раннего начала данной работы и ее продолжительности
R |
= tп.н − t р.н − t |
i− j |
. |
(4.8) |
i− j |
i− j i− j |
|
|
Частный (свободный) резерв времени – это время, на которое можно увеличить продолжительность данной работы, или перенести ее начало на более поздний срок без изменения раннего начала последующих работ. Частный резерв времени определяют как разность раннего начала последующей работы и раннего окончания данной работы или же – по разности ранних начал и продолжительности самой работы:
272
![](/html/1438/356/html_tUn5EFvP8z.S5fz/htmlconvd-b1oA1V273x1.jpg)
r р.о = t р.н − tп.о |
или r |
= t р.н − t р.н − t |
i− j |
. (4.9) |
|
i− j |
i−k i− j |
i− j |
i−k i− j |
|
Частный резерв времени любой работы не может быть больше по своему значению общего резерва. Он или равен общему резерву времени, или меньше его, но не меньше нуля.
Для критических работ частные и общие резервы равны нулю.
Общий резерв времени какой-либо работы равен сумме ее частного резерва и частных резервов всей цепочки последующих работ вплоть до события, через которое проходит критический путь.
Если ранние параметры сетевого графика определяют последовательным переходом от события к событию слева направо, а поздние, наоборот, справа налево, то резервы времени можно подсчитывать в любом направлении, в том числе, и выборочно.
Указанные зависимости и закономерности параметров сетевого графика служат основой для применения расчета и контроля секторным или табличным способом вручную (до
300событий), а также программирования расчетов на ПЭВМ.
Внастоящее время существует несколько способов расчета сетевых графиков. Расчет непосредственно на графике (его еще называют секторным) – самый простой и быстрый способ расчета сетевой модели, который заключается в следующем:
•каждое событие разбивается на четыре сектора; номер события заносится в верхний сектор (рис. 4.11); в левый сектор записывается раннее начало работ, выходящих из данного события; в правый – позднее окончание работ, входящих в данное событие, а в нижний сектор – номер предшествующего события, через которое к данному идет максимальный путь;
|
|
|
|
собi |
|
|
|
Работа h-i |
|
N |
|||||
р.н. |
|
|
п.о |
. |
|||
|
|
ti-j |
|
|
th-i |
||
|
|
|
|
||||
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
Работа i-j
Номер предшествующего события, через которое к данному идет максимальный путь
Рис. 4.11. Вариант формы записи результатов расчета
•определяется максимальное раннее начало каждой работы, значение которого проставляется в левый сектор каждого события; расчет ведется от исходного до завершающего события в порядке возрастания нумерации (слева направо);
•определяется минимально позднее окончание каждой работы, значение, которого проставляется в правый сектор каждого события; расчет ведется в обратном порядке: от завершающего до исходного события в порядке убывания нумерации графика (справа налево);
•определяется и графически выделяется критический путь, длина которого характеризует общую продолжительность работ (строительства); критический путь проходит через события, у которых значения левого сектора равны значению правого, так как работы на критическом пути не имеют резервов времени;
•определяются частные резервы времени по каждой работе путем вычитания из значения левого сектора конечного события данной работы суммы значений левого сектора начального события данной работы и ее продолжительности;
•определяются общие резервы времени по каждой работе путем вычитания числового значения правого сектора конечного события суммы значений левого сектора начального события данной работы и ее продолжительности.
273
![](/html/1438/356/html_tUn5EFvP8z.S5fz/htmlconvd-b1oA1V274x1.jpg)
Вычисленные значения частного и общего резервов времени обычно записывают над работой в прямоугольнике, разделенном на две части. В левой половине записывают величину частного резерва времени, а в правой – величину общего резерва.
Сетевой график, рассчитываемый секторным способом, целесообразно рассмотреть более подробно и на конкретном примере. Последовательность расчета и содержание этапов работ можно изложить следующим образом.
ПЕРВЫЙ ЭТАП. Определяют ранние сроки начала работ. Рассчитывают слева направо от исходного до завершающего события. При этом заполняют только левые секторы событий, принимая за начало максимальную продолжительность пути, ведущего от начала (исходного события) к данному событию.
В исходном событии ранний срок принимается равным нулю (оно не имеет предшествующих работ), и это значение вписывается в левый сектор первого события. Затем к нему прибавляют продолжительность рассматриваемой работы и полученный результат ставят в левый сектор следующего события.
Например: раннее начало работы в событии 2 (рис. 4.12) будет равно 2, то есть к нулю левого сектора события 1 прибавили продолжительность рассматриваемой работы 1-2, равную двум (первая цифра под чертой). Если к событию подходит две или несколько работ, то принимают наибольшее значение из всех работ, входящих в данное событие. Так, к событию 5 подходят две работы 3-5 и 2-5. Продолжительность пути по работе 3-5 (из исходного события) составляет 14 дней (6+8), а по работе 2-5 6 дней (2+4), значит в левый сектор события 5 записывают цифру 14, то есть из двух – максимальную; к событию 6 также подходят две работы 3-6 и 4-6, пути по которым соответственно будут равны: 11 (6+5) и 9 (3+6). Следовательно, записываем в левый сектор события 6 цифру 11 и так далее.
|
|
|
|
|
|
|
|
|
|
|
2 |
|
|
8 |
|
8 |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
0 |
|
8 |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|||||||
|
|
|
|
|
|
|
|
|
|
2 |
10 |
|
4-1-15 |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
||||
|
2-1-5 |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
||||||||||||||
|
|
|
|
1 |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
||||||||||||
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
1 |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
0 |
0 |
|
|
|
3 |
|
|
|
0 |
0 |
|
|
|
|
5 |
|
|
0 |
0 |
|
|
|
|
7 |
|
|||||
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
||||||||||||||
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|||||||||||||||||||||
0 |
|
0 |
|
|
|
|
|
|
|
|
|
6 |
|
6 |
|
|
|
|
|
14 |
14 |
|
|
|
|
|
|
24 |
24 |
|
|||||||
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|||||||||||||||||
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
||||||||||||||||||
|
|
6-1-8 |
|
|
|
8-1-6 |
|
|
10-1-4 |
|
|||||||||||||||||||||||||||
|
|
|
|
|
|
|
|
|
1 |
|
|
|
|
|
|
3 |
|
|
|
|
5 |
|
|||||||||||||||
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|||||||||||||||||||||||
|
0 |
|
|
|
|
|
|
|
|
|
|
|
|
|
|||||||||||||||||||||||
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
0 |
|
4 |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
4 |
|
|
|
5-1-2 |
|
11 |
6 |
15 |
|
4 |
|
4 |
|
||||||
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
||||||||||||
|
|
|
|
|
|
|
|
|
|
|
|
0 |
6 |
|
|
|
|
|
|
|
|
|
|
|
|
3 |
9-1-13 |
|
|||||||||
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|||||||||
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
3 |
9 |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
3-1-7 |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|||||
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
1 |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
||||
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
2 |
|
6 |
|
|
|
|
|
|
|
|
|
|
|
6-1-10
Рис. 4.12. Расчет сети на графике секторным способом
ВТОРОЙ ЭТАП. Определяют поздние сроки окончания работ. Рассчитывают справа налево (от завершающего к исходному событию). Заполняют правые секторы событий сетевого графика. Для последнего события (в данном случае 7) максимально раннее начало работ равно 24 дням. Последующих работ нет. Поэтому поздний срок окончания завершающих работ равен раннему началу работ, то есть цифру 24 механически переносят в правый сектор события 7 и начинают рассчитывать поздние сроки всех остальных работ. В правый сектор каждого события записывают минимальные значения разности между поздним окончанием последующей работы и продолжительностью рассматриваемой.
274
![](/html/1438/356/html_tUn5EFvP8z.S5fz/htmlconvd-b1oA1V276x1.jpg)
![](/html/1438/356/html_tUn5EFvP8z.S5fz/htmlconvd-b1oA1V277x1.jpg)
![](/html/1438/356/html_tUn5EFvP8z.S5fz/htmlconvd-b1oA1V280x1.jpg)